📂 Data Retention Policy – SunnahMarriageHub
Last updated: September 2025
At SunnahMarriageHub, we respect your privacy and comply with the UK GDPR. This policy explains what data we keep, how long we keep it, and why.
We only collect and store the minimum data necessary to operate the platform securely.
Data is retained only for as long as needed for the purposes set out in this policy.
When data is no longer required, it is securely deleted or anonymised.
Email, mobile number, and profile details: kept while your account is active.
If you close your account, this information will be deleted within 30 days, except where required by law (e.g. fraud prevention).
Passport/DVLA ID documents:
We do not store raw copies of your passport or driving licence once verification is complete.
Instead, we record a “Verified” status and the date of verification.
If a third-party verification provider (e.g. Onfido, Yoti) is used, they may retain documents in line with their own GDPR-compliant policies.
Chat history between users is retained for 12 months to:
Ensure safety and transparency.
Assist in case of disputes, fraud, or reports of harassment.
Support cooperation with lawful requests from authorities.
After 12 months, chat history is permanently deleted.
Login records, IP addresses, and device information are retained for 12 months to detect fraud, enhance security, and prevent misuse.
Payments are processed securely by Stripe.
We do not store your full credit card details. Stripe may retain limited transaction information as required for financial regulations.
We may retain certain records longer if:
Required by law.
Needed for fraud prevention.
In connection with ongoing investigations or legal claims.
Under UK GDPR, you have the right to:
Request a copy of your data.
Request deletion of your data (subject to legal obligations).
Withdraw consent where applicable.
